Requirements

  • Experience in AI/ML solution development
  • Experience designing and implementing Intelligent Document Processing (IDP) solutions for document classification and information extraction
  • Proven ability to lead technically and deliver in a time-bound environment
  • Experience with AI/ML frameworks — TensorFlow, PyTorch, Scikit-learn, Hugging Face, LangChain or equivalent
  • Experience in AWS core services, SageMaker.
  •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ent required from an accredited institution. Will also consider three years of progressive experience in the specialty in lieu of every year of education.
  • All applicants authorized to work in the United States are encouraged to apply.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ience in OCR for extracting data from PDFs, scanned images (Big Map), and Word documents
  • Document auto-classification using AI/ML — solving real business problem of misfiled documents (e.g., 1040 filed as W2)
  • Experience in NLP and Computer Vision for document understanding.
  • Experience in Large Language Models (LLMs) for document understanding.
